Instance Method Details
#domains_archive(id, opts = {}) ⇒ Domain
Archive a domain Soft-archive a domain (it is versioned, never hard-deleted). Archiving a monitoring domain also revokes its collection addresses, so DMARC report ingestion stops with it; restore re-enables them.
27 28 29 30 |
# File 'lib/norbelys/api/domains_api.rb', line 27 def domains_archive(id, opts = {}) data, _status_code, _headers = domains_archive_with_http_info(id, opts) data end |
#domains_archive_with_http_info(id, opts = {}) ⇒ Array<(Domain, Integer, Hash)>
Archive a domain Soft-archive a domain (it is versioned, never hard-deleted). Archiving a monitoring domain also revokes its collection addresses, so DMARC report ingestion stops with it; restore re-enables them.
37 38 39 40 41 42 43 44 45 46 47 48 49 50 51 52 53 54 55 56 57 58 59 60 61 62 63 64 65 66 67 68 69 70 71 72 73 74 75 76 77 78 79 80 81 82 83 |
# File 'lib/norbelys/api/domains_api.rb', line 37 def domains_archive_with_http_info(id, opts = {}) if @api_client.config.debugging @api_client.config.logger.debug 'Calling API: DomainsApi.domains_archive ...' end # verify the required parameter 'id' is set if @api_client.config.client_side_validation && id.nil? fail ArgumentError, "Missing the required parameter 'id' when calling DomainsApi.domains_archive" end # resource path local_var_path = '/domains/{id}'.sub('{' + 'id' + '}', CGI.escape(id.to_s)) # query parameters query_params = opts[:query_params] || {} # header parameters header_params = opts[:header_params] || {} # HTTP header 'Accept' (if needed) header_params['Accept'] = @api_client.select_header_accept(['application/json']) unless header_params['Accept'] # form parameters form_params = opts[:form_params] || {} # http body (model) post_body = opts[:debug_body] # return_type return_type = opts[:debug_return_type] || 'Domain' # auth_names auth_names = opts[:debug_auth_names] || ['bearerAuth'] = opts.merge( :operation => :"DomainsApi.domains_archive", :header_params => header_params, :query_params => query_params, :form_params => form_params, :body => post_body, :auth_names => auth_names, :return_type => return_type ) data, status_code, headers = @api_client.call_api(:DELETE, local_var_path, ) if @api_client.config.debugging @api_client.config.logger.debug "API called: DomainsApi#domains_archive\nData: #{data.inspect}\nStatus code: #{status_code}\nHeaders: #{headers}" end return data, status_code, headers end |
#domains_create(domain_create_params, opts = {}) ⇒ Domain
Create a domain
Provision a domain by capability. A sending domain registers a cold/SMTP mailbox domain (normally born automatically when you connect a mailbox); a monitoring domain starts DMARC monitoring and auto-mints its first collection address (read it back with find?expand=collectionAddresses). The common manual use is adding an external monitor-only domain.
91 92 93 94 |
# File 'lib/norbelys/api/domains_api.rb', line 91 def domains_create(domain_create_params, opts = {}) data, _status_code, _headers = domains_create_with_http_info(domain_create_params, opts) data end |
#domains_create_with_http_info(domain_create_params, opts = {}) ⇒ Array<(Domain, Integer, Hash)>
Create a domain Provision a domain by capability. A `sending` domain registers a cold/SMTP mailbox domain (normally born automatically when you connect a mailbox); a `monitoring` domain starts DMARC monitoring and auto-mints its first collection address (read it back with find?expand=collectionAddresses). The common manual use is adding an external monitor-only domain.
102 103 104 105 106 107 108 109 110 111 112 113 114 115 116 117 118 119 120 121 122 123 124 125 126 127 128 129 130 131 132 133 134 135 136 137 138 139 140 141 142 143 144 145 146 147 148 149 150 151 152 153 154 155 156 157 158 |
# File 'lib/norbelys/api/domains_api.rb', line 102 def domains_create_with_http_info(domain_create_params, opts = {}) if @api_client.config.debugging @api_client.config.logger.debug 'Calling API: DomainsApi.domains_create ...' end # verify the required parameter 'domain_create_params' is set if @api_client.config.client_side_validation && domain_create_params.nil? fail ArgumentError, "Missing the required parameter 'domain_create_params' when calling DomainsApi.domains_create" end if @api_client.config.client_side_validation && !opts[:'idempotency_key'].nil? && opts[:'idempotency_key'].to_s.length > 255 fail ArgumentError, 'invalid value for "opts[:"idempotency_key"]" when calling DomainsApi.domains_create, the character length must be smaller than or equal to 255.' end # resource path local_var_path = '/domains' # query parameters query_params = opts[:query_params] || {} # header parameters header_params = opts[:header_params] || {} # HTTP header 'Accept' (if needed) header_params['Accept'] = @api_client.select_header_accept(['application/json']) unless header_params['Accept'] # HTTP header 'Content-Type' content_type = @api_client.select_header_content_type(['application/json']) if !content_type.nil? header_params['Content-Type'] = content_type end header_params[:'Idempotency-Key'] = opts[:'idempotency_key'] if !opts[:'idempotency_key'].nil? # form parameters form_params = opts[:form_params] || {} # http body (model) post_body = opts[:debug_body] || @api_client.object_to_http_body(domain_create_params) # return_type return_type = opts[:debug_return_type] || 'Domain' # auth_names auth_names = opts[:debug_auth_names] || ['bearerAuth'] = opts.merge( :operation => :"DomainsApi.domains_create", :header_params => header_params, :query_params => query_params, :form_params => form_params, :body => post_body, :auth_names => auth_names, :return_type => return_type ) data, status_code, headers = @api_client.call_api(:POST, local_var_path, ) if @api_client.config.debugging @api_client.config.logger.debug "API called: DomainsApi#domains_create\nData: #{data.inspect}\nStatus code: #{status_code}\nHeaders: #{headers}" end return data, status_code, headers end |
#domains_find(id, opts = {}) ⇒ DomainDetail
Get a domain Read one domain (a monitoring domain reports its DMARC collection readiness on read). Pass expand=collectionAddresses to inline the rua addresses reports are sent to.
166 167 168 169 |
# File 'lib/norbelys/api/domains_api.rb', line 166 def domains_find(id, opts = {}) data, _status_code, _headers = domains_find_with_http_info(id, opts) data end |
#domains_find_with_http_info(id, opts = {}) ⇒ Array<(DomainDetail, Integer, Hash)>
Get a domain Read one domain (a monitoring domain reports its DMARC collection readiness on read). Pass expand=collectionAddresses to inline the rua addresses reports are sent to.
177 178 179 180 181 182 183 184 185 186 187 188 189 190 191 192 193 194 195 196 197 198 199 200 201 202 203 204 205 206 207 208 209 210 211 212 213 214 215 216 217 218 219 220 221 222 223 224 225 226 227 228 |
# File 'lib/norbelys/api/domains_api.rb', line 177 def domains_find_with_http_info(id, opts = {}) if @api_client.config.debugging @api_client.config.logger.debug 'Calling API: DomainsApi.domains_find ...' end # verify the required parameter 'id' is set if @api_client.config.client_side_validation && id.nil? fail ArgumentError, "Missing the required parameter 'id' when calling DomainsApi.domains_find" end allowable_values = ["collectionAddresses", "trackingDomains"] if @api_client.config.client_side_validation && opts[:'expand'] && !opts[:'expand'].all? { |item| allowable_values.include?(item) } fail ArgumentError, "invalid value for \"expand\", must include one of #{allowable_values}" end # resource path local_var_path = '/domains/{id}'.sub('{' + 'id' + '}', CGI.escape(id.to_s)) # query parameters query_params = opts[:query_params] || {} query_params[:'expand'] = @api_client.build_collection_param(opts[:'expand'], :csv) if !opts[:'expand'].nil? # header parameters header_params = opts[:header_params] || {} # HTTP header 'Accept' (if needed) header_params['Accept'] = @api_client.select_header_accept(['application/json']) unless header_params['Accept'] # form parameters form_params = opts[:form_params] || {} # http body (model) post_body = opts[:debug_body] # return_type return_type = opts[:debug_return_type] || 'DomainDetail' # auth_names auth_names = opts[:debug_auth_names] || ['bearerAuth'] = opts.merge( :operation => :"DomainsApi.domains_find", :header_params => header_params, :query_params => query_params, :form_params => form_params, :body => post_body, :auth_names => auth_names, :return_type => return_type ) data, status_code, headers = @api_client.call_api(:GET, local_var_path, ) if @api_client.config.debugging @api_client.config.logger.debug "API called: DomainsApi#domains_find\nData: #{data.inspect}\nStatus code: #{status_code}\nHeaders: #{headers}" end return data, status_code, headers end |
#domains_list(opts = {}) ⇒ DomainList
List domains List your domains — both sending domains and DMARC-monitoring domains. Filter by capability, or pass programId to scope to the sending domains a campaign sends from (adds senderCount).
239 240 241 242 |
# File 'lib/norbelys/api/domains_api.rb', line 239 def domains_list(opts = {}) data, _status_code, _headers = domains_list_with_http_info(opts) data end |
#domains_list_with_http_info(opts = {}) ⇒ Array<(DomainList, Integer, Hash)>
List domains List your domains — both sending domains and DMARC-monitoring domains. Filter by capability, or pass programId to scope to the sending domains a campaign sends from (adds senderCount).
253 254 255 256 257 258 259 260 261 262 263 264 265 266 267 268 269 270 271 272 273 274 275 276 277 278 279 280 281 282 283 284 285 286 287 288 289 290 291 292 293 294 295 296 297 298 299 300 301 302 303 304 305 306 307 308 309 310 311 312 |
# File 'lib/norbelys/api/domains_api.rb', line 253 def domains_list_with_http_info(opts = {}) if @api_client.config.debugging @api_client.config.logger.debug 'Calling API: DomainsApi.domains_list ...' end if @api_client.config.client_side_validation && !opts[:'limit'].nil? && opts[:'limit'] > 100 fail ArgumentError, 'invalid value for "opts[:"limit"]" when calling DomainsApi.domains_list, must be smaller than or equal to 100.' end if @api_client.config.client_side_validation && !opts[:'limit'].nil? && opts[:'limit'] < 1 fail ArgumentError, 'invalid value for "opts[:"limit"]" when calling DomainsApi.domains_list, must be greater than or equal to 1.' end allowable_values = ["sending", "monitoring", "tracking"] if @api_client.config.client_side_validation && opts[:'capability'] && !allowable_values.include?(opts[:'capability']) fail ArgumentError, "invalid value for \"capability\", must be one of #{allowable_values}" end # resource path local_var_path = '/domains' # query parameters query_params = opts[:query_params] || {} query_params[:'cursor'] = opts[:'cursor'] if !opts[:'cursor'].nil? query_params[:'includeArchived'] = opts[:'include_archived'] if !opts[:'include_archived'].nil? query_params[:'limit'] = opts[:'limit'] if !opts[:'limit'].nil? query_params[:'capability'] = opts[:'capability'] if !opts[:'capability'].nil? query_params[:'programId'] = opts[:'program_id'] if !opts[:'program_id'].nil? # header parameters header_params = opts[:header_params] || {} # HTTP header 'Accept' (if needed) header_params['Accept'] = @api_client.select_header_accept(['application/json']) unless header_params['Accept'] # form parameters form_params = opts[:form_params] || {} # http body (model) post_body = opts[:debug_body] # return_type return_type = opts[:debug_return_type] || 'DomainList' # auth_names auth_names = opts[:debug_auth_names] || ['bearerAuth'] = opts.merge( :operation => :"DomainsApi.domains_list", :header_params => header_params, :query_params => query_params, :form_params => form_params, :body => post_body, :auth_names => auth_names, :return_type => return_type ) data, status_code, headers = @api_client.call_api(:GET, local_var_path, ) if @api_client.config.debugging @api_client.config.logger.debug "API called: DomainsApi#domains_list\nData: #{data.inspect}\nStatus code: #{status_code}\nHeaders: #{headers}" end return data, status_code, headers end |

#domains_share(id, opts = {}) ⇒ ReportShare
Share the DMARC report Mint a public, read-only link to this monitoring domain's DMARC report (send it to a client — no account needed). The link is signed and expires after 30 days; archiving the domain kills it immediately. Mint again for a fresh link.
390 391 392 393 |
# File 'lib/norbelys/api/domains_api.rb', line 390 def domains_share(id, opts = {}) data, _status_code, _headers = domains_share_with_http_info(id, opts) data end |
#domains_share_with_http_info(id, opts = {}) ⇒ Array<(ReportShare, Integer, Hash)>
Share the DMARC report Mint a public, read-only link to this monitoring domain's DMARC report (send it to a client — no account needed). The link is signed and expires after 30 days; archiving the domain kills it immediately. Mint again for a fresh link.
401 402 403 404 405 406 407 408 409 410 411 412 413 414 415 416 417 418 419 420 421 422 423 424 425 426 427 428 429 430 431 432 433 434 435 436 437 438 439 440 441 442 443 444 445 446 447 448 449 450 451 452 |
# File 'lib/norbelys/api/domains_api.rb', line 401 def domains_share_with_http_info(id, opts = {}) if @api_client.config.debugging @api_client.config.logger.debug 'Calling API: DomainsApi.domains_share ...' end # verify the required parameter 'id' is set if @api_client.config.client_side_validation && id.nil? fail ArgumentError, "Missing the required parameter 'id' when calling DomainsApi.domains_share" end if @api_client.config.client_side_validation && !opts[:'idempotency_key'].nil? && opts[:'idempotency_key'].to_s.length > 255 fail ArgumentError, 'invalid value for "opts[:"idempotency_key"]" when calling DomainsApi.domains_share, the character length must be smaller than or equal to 255.' end # resource path local_var_path = '/domains/{id}/share'.sub('{' + 'id' + '}', CGI.escape(id.to_s)) # query parameters query_params = opts[:query_params] || {} # header parameters header_params = opts[:header_params] || {} # HTTP header 'Accept' (if needed) header_params['Accept'] = @api_client.select_header_accept(['application/json']) unless header_params['Accept'] header_params[:'Idempotency-Key'] = opts[:'idempotency_key'] if !opts[:'idempotency_key'].nil? # form parameters form_params = opts[:form_params] || {} # http body (model) post_body = opts[:debug_body] # return_type return_type = opts[:debug_return_type] || 'ReportShare' # auth_names auth_names = opts[:debug_auth_names] || ['bearerAuth'] = opts.merge( :operation => :"DomainsApi.domains_share", :header_params => header_params, :query_params => query_params, :form_params => form_params, :body => post_body, :auth_names => auth_names, :return_type => return_type ) data, status_code, headers = @api_client.call_api(:POST, local_var_path, ) if @api_client.config.debugging @api_client.config.logger.debug "API called: DomainsApi#domains_share\nData: #{data.inspect}\nStatus code: #{status_code}\nHeaders: #{headers}" end return data, status_code, headers end |
#domains_update(id, domain_update_params, opts = {}) ⇒ Domain
Update a domain Update customer-owned settings on a sending or tracking domain. Operational DNS, TLS, health, recommendation, and capacity fields are read-only. The required version provides optimistic concurrency.
460 461 462 463 |
# File 'lib/norbelys/api/domains_api.rb', line 460 def domains_update(id, domain_update_params, opts = {}) data, _status_code, _headers = domains_update_with_http_info(id, domain_update_params, opts) data end |
#domains_update_with_http_info(id, domain_update_params, opts = {}) ⇒ Array<(Domain, Integer, Hash)>
Update a domain Update customer-owned settings on a sending or tracking domain. Operational DNS, TLS, health, recommendation, and capacity fields are read-only. The required version provides optimistic concurrency.
471 472 473 474 475 476 477 478 479 480 481 482 483 484 485 486 487 488 489 490 491 492 493 494 495 496 497 498 499 500 501 502 503 504 505 506 507 508 509 510 511 512 513 514 515 516 517 518 519 520 521 522 523 524 525 526 |
# File 'lib/norbelys/api/domains_api.rb', line 471 def domains_update_with_http_info(id, domain_update_params, opts = {}) if @api_client.config.debugging @api_client.config.logger.debug 'Calling API: DomainsApi.domains_update ...' end # verify the required parameter 'id' is set if @api_client.config.client_side_validation && id.nil? fail ArgumentError, "Missing the required parameter 'id' when calling DomainsApi.domains_update" end # verify the required parameter 'domain_update_params' is set if @api_client.config.client_side_validation && domain_update_params.nil? fail ArgumentError, "Missing the required parameter 'domain_update_params' when calling DomainsApi.domains_update" end # resource path local_var_path = '/domains/{id}'.sub('{' + 'id' + '}', CGI.escape(id.to_s)) # query parameters query_params = opts[:query_params] || {} # header parameters header_params = opts[:header_params] || {} # HTTP header 'Accept' (if needed) header_params['Accept'] = @api_client.select_header_accept(['application/json']) unless header_params['Accept'] # HTTP header 'Content-Type' content_type = @api_client.select_header_content_type(['application/json']) if !content_type.nil? header_params['Content-Type'] = content_type end # form parameters form_params = opts[:form_params] || {} # http body (model) post_body = opts[:debug_body] || @api_client.object_to_http_body(domain_update_params) # return_type return_type = opts[:debug_return_type] || 'Domain' # auth_names auth_names = opts[:debug_auth_names] || ['bearerAuth'] = opts.merge( :operation => :"DomainsApi.domains_update", :header_params => header_params, :query_params => query_params, :form_params => form_params, :body => post_body, :auth_names => auth_names, :return_type => return_type ) data, status_code, headers = @api_client.call_api(:PATCH, local_var_path, ) if @api_client.config.debugging @api_client.config.logger.debug "API called: DomainsApi#domains_update\nData: #{data.inspect}\nStatus code: #{status_code}\nHeaders: #{headers}" end return data, status_code, headers end |
